Transaction 0591336865fde236cf501a7d4fe016061f95b0d17c61b11c22f4a48f3080f885

2 Input
2 Outputs
  • 0591336865fde236cf501a7d4fe016061f95b0d17c61b11c22f4a48f3080f885:0
  • value  77416
    address  19f7dfpoJuBfCnWi2ZM9jQzrEsZLJiXkcz
  • 0591336865fde236cf501a7d4fe016061f95b0d17c61b11c22f4a48f3080f885:1
  • value  12299794
    address  1xAPSKWyJogPDsoyDvhkStrRaRyefqxqv